## Problem Overview

Plant managers and operations directors face constant production bottlenecks due to the time required to train new floor operators. As veteran workers retire or shift roles, their tribal knowledge leaves with them, forcing facilities to rely on manual shadowing. This ties up top-performing operators, pulling them off active production lines to supervise new hires through complex physical workflows.

Existing training methods rely on static text manuals and generic learning management systems built for desk workers, not hands-on machine operation. Standard operating procedures exist as disconnected documents that cannot provide situational guidance on the factory floor. When unexpected machine faults or edge-case material defects occur, new operators lack the immediate reference needed to resolve the issue without halting the line.

High baseline turnover in industrial roles forces facilities into a perpetual cycle of onboarding. Because the gap between textbook safety compliance and actual operational rhythm is vast, achieving target cycle times takes months per worker. The lack of dynamic, context-aware training aids traps manufacturing throughput behind the learning curve of the newest employees.

## Problem Why Now

The manufacturing sector is hitting a strict demographic cliff as veteran operators retire, taking decades of uncodified tribal knowledge with them. At the same time, recent reshoring initiatives mandate rapid factory scale-up, suddenly exposing the fragility of manual shadowing. Per National Association of Manufacturers (NAM ~2023) estimates, over two million manufacturing jobs could remain unfilled by the end of the decade due to this exact skills gap, making accelerated onboarding a baseline production requirement.

Previous attempts to digitize floor training relied on rigid learning management systems or hard-coded augmented reality headsets. These tools failed because they required hundreds of software engineering hours to map every possible machine state into a fixed decision tree, rendering them brittle the moment a physical line configuration changed. Floor operators routinely abandoned these static systems because they could not handle edge-case material defects or unexpected machine faults, forcing a reversion to tap-on-the-shoulder supervision.

The structural fix is only possible now because multimodal artificial intelligence has crossed a critical threshold in physical context understanding. Current vision-language models can instantly ingest live video feeds from a factory floor, cross-reference that visual state against unstructured technical manuals, and identify specific machine anomalies in real time. This shift means dynamic, context-aware guidance operates directly at the point of assembly without requiring IT teams to pre-program every conceivable fault scenario.

## Problem Current Solutions

**Status Quo**: Plant managers pair new hires with veteran operators for weeks of direct manual shadowing, supplemented by static text manuals housed in generic learning management systems.
**Workarounds**:
- laminated cheat sheets taped to machines
- calling veteran operators off the active line
- shift-specific WhatsApp group chats
- writing tribal knowledge on whiteboards

**Why Insufficient**: Traditional learning management systems and static document repositories are fundamentally disconnected from the physical machine context. They cannot provide dynamic, situational guidance when an operator encounters unexpected hardware faults or edge-case material defects on the factory floor.

**Market Dynamics**: The market is fragmenting away from centralized corporate learning management systems toward specialized frontline worker platforms, driven by the need to capture undocumented tribal knowledge directly at the operational edge.
**Competition Concentration**: Established enterprise learning management systems and document repositories cluster heavily in the off-floor, static procedures quadrant. Digitized frontline worker platforms offer in-situ delivery but remain concentrated on static, top-down authored checklists and manuals. The quadrant representing dynamic, situational resolution delivered at the machine-side is largely unoccupied by formal software, currently dominated by manual substitutes like messaging apps and pulling veterans off the production line.
